Knapsack sprayers are a preferred choice for both professional farmers and amateur gardeners. Developed for simplicity of usage, these sprayers have a backpack-like layout that permits customers to carry a storage tank loaded with plant foods, herbicides, or chemicals straight on their back. When splashing hard-to-reach areas, this design not just boosts wheelchair however also permits for better precision. Knapsack sprayers are generally equipped with a pump that creates stress to dispense the liquid, making it possible for a controlled application. With flexible nozzles, individuals can switch in between great mists for fragile plants and more focused streams for bigger areas or challenging weeds. The capability to easily readjust the spray pattern makes knapsack sprayers flexible tools, appropriate for a variety of jobs in different kinds of agriculture or cultivation.

On the various other hand, manual sprayers are commonly checked out as the most basic type of spraying devices. While they may not provide the same degree of performance as some electric designs, manual sprayers are lightweight, incredibly mobile, and cost-efficient.

Hose nozzles, while not sprayers in the standard feeling, play an important duty in yard maintenance. Unlike standalone sprayers, hose nozzles take advantage of an existing water resource, allowing individuals to cover bigger locations without the need to fill up a different container frequently.

Electric sprayers have gotten appeal in recent years, especially among experts that require to cover substantial areas efficiently. These sprayers utilize a mechanized pump to supply a consistent circulation of fluid, minimizing both the initiative and fatigue connected with manual spraying methods. Electric sprayers typically include large-capacity containers, permitting for expanded splashing sessions without constant refill disturbances. In addition, lots of versions consist of sophisticated features such as automatic shut-off systems, adjustable pressure settings, and built-in filters to avoid clogging, making them highly reliable for numerous applications, from big agricultural fields to expansive residential yards. Electric sprayers can manage a variety of liquids, including herbicides, pesticides, and fluid fertilizers, providing a reliable method to keep a large yard or farm operating smoothly.

The option between a knapsack sprayer, manual sprayer, hose nozzle, and electric sprayer frequently depends on the specific needs of the customer. Those taking care of big tracts of land or dealing with severe pest problems might lean in the direction of electric sprayers for their effectiveness and ease of usage.

No matter the type of sprayer chosen, it is critical to consider variables such as the tank ability, weight, and the kind of nozzle provided. For example, people with larger yards may select a sprayer with a greater storage tank capacity to decrease refill intervals, while those operating in tight space setups might focus on a lightweight layout that enables for easy ability to move. In addition, the type of nozzle can substantially impact spray patterns and insurance coverage area, making it necessary to select a version that can be adjusted according to the certain application handy.

Safety and security must always be a critical consideration when making use of any type of type of sprayer. Users need to likewise follow advised application prices to avoid over-spraying, which can harm plants or contribute to ecological injury.

Moreover, recognizing the different strategies for making use of these sprayers can enhance performance. For instance, timing plays an essential function in parasite administration; using treatments early in the early morning or late in the evening can lower evaporation and boost absorption, especially if utilizing water-based solutions. The understanding of wind patterns is additionally vital when making use of anything that disperses chemicals, as it can impact the instructions and drift of spray. Training in proper technique, such as preserving a consistent distance from the target surface and utilizing a consistent activity, can result in much better application and much less overspray.

As tensions rise around herbicide and pesticide use due to environmental issues, numerous gardeners are seeking option options. Integrated Pest Management (IPM) strategies, which include the use of organic controls, social techniques, and cautious use chemical controls, emphasize the need for a more thoughtful approach to garden upkeep. Making use of sprayers as component of an IPM program can considerably improve the efficiency of these strategies, allowing garden enthusiasts to use pesticides only when definitely needed and in a targeted way that minimizes ecological influence.

Several formulations created for natural use can be successfully used using both manual and electric sprayers. Self-made remedies, such as neem oil, garlic spray, or insecticidal soap, can be conveniently dispensed utilizing these devices, advertising eco-friendly gardening methods.
